Building Strong Relationships with Customers
Building strong relationships with customers fosters loyalty. Companies should prioritize engagement initiatives that enhance their connections with customers. Regular interactions, whether through newsletters, social media, or direct outreach, can help businesses stay top-of-mind. Personalization plays a significant role in relationship-building; therefore, businesses must analyze customer data to provide relevant offerings. Recognizing customer milestones, such as anniversaries or birthdays, with special discounts or personalized messages can enhance perceived value. Developing loyalty programs featuring rewards can also motivate repeat purchases while making customers feel valued. Furthermore, transparency and honesty in communications cultivate trust. Preventing misunderstandings or resolving issues promptly can leave a lasting impression on customers and enhance overall satisfaction. Employees must be empowered to make decisions that reflect the company’s commitment to customer care; this accelerates issue resolution and reinforces the customer’s belief in the brand. Open dialogue through various feedback channels allows customers to voice their opinions, reinforcing the idea that their voices are heard. By prioritizing customer relations, businesses will create an ecosystem where customers are satisfied and become advocates and promoters of the brand.
In addition to relationship-building, resolving complaints efficiently enhances overall customer satisfaction. It’s essential that companies adopt a proactive approach when addressing complaints. Establishing a clear procedure for handling and responding to complaints ensures consistency, which customers appreciate. Employees should be trained to handle complaints with empathy and urgency. Responding positively to customer concerns can transform potentially negative experiences into opportunities for loyalty. For example, a customer dissatisfied with a product may become a loyal patron if their concern is handled appropriately and promptly. Follow-up communication after resolving issues helps to ensure that customers feel valued. Companies may also consider implementing a formal complaint management strategy, which may include analysis of complaints to identify common issues. By addressing root causes, they can improve services or products, preventing recurring complaints. Celebrating successful resolutions and customer recovery stories internally can provide staff with motivation and examples of excellent service. Businesses that manage grievances effectively will not only increase customer satisfaction but will also benefit from more robust reputations within their markets.
Utilizing Customer Feedback for Continuous Improvement
Leverage customer feedback for continuous improvement in products and services. Companies should build a robust feedback system, which regularly captures insights from customers. Various methods can be utilized, such as satisfaction surveys, online reviews, and Net Promoter Scores (NPS). The information gathered should serve as a guiding principle for improving overall business strategies. Analyzing feedback provides valuable insights into areas needing enhancement, as well as those where the company excels. Consideration should be given to both positive and negative feedback, as the former can highlight best practices, while the latter indicates necessary improvements. Additionally, creating a feedback loop where customers are informed about modifications made based on their insights fosters loyalty and trust. Implementing changes demonstrates that the company values its customers’ opinions and is committed to enhancing their experience. Ensuring frequent communication about progress in addressing concerns shows responsiveness and adaptability. Companies should also foster a culture where employees feel empowered to suggest improvements based on customer interactions. This will create a unified team aiming toward better customer satisfaction outcomes.

Measuring the Impact of Satisfaction Strategies
Measuring the effectiveness of customer satisfaction strategies is paramount for understanding their impact over time. Regular evaluation of satisfaction scores and the effectiveness of the initiatives implemented provides a clearer picture of customer responses. Companies can utilize tools such as customer satisfaction surveys, online reviews, and social media sentiments to gauge performance. Analyzing data trends can reveal which strategies are yielding positive results and which ones need revision. Furthermore, correlating satisfaction levels with business outcomes such as sales growth, retention rates, and referrals establishes the importance of customer satisfaction in the broader context. It’s also essential to maintain transparency with stakeholders about the progress achieved and goals set. Sharing success stories can motivate teams and reinforce a customer-first culture within the organization. Establish regular check-ins on satisfaction metrics to keep them at the forefront of the business strategy. Continuous improvement cycles ensure that customer satisfaction remains a priority within the company and seeks ongoing enhancement. Proactively adjusting strategies based on measurement outcomes will enhance the engagement and satisfaction scores significantly.
